Why Automate Your Shopify Store?
Automation isn't about replacing human judgment; it's about eliminating repetitive tasks.
- Customer Service: AI chatbots handle 60-80% of common queries (order status, returns, basic product questions).
- Marketing: AI can generate personalized email sequences, social media posts, and ad copy based on customer behavior.
- Content Creation: Product descriptions, blog posts, and meta tags can be drafted instantly.
- Inventory & Pricing: AI tools analyze sales data to suggest restocking alerts or dynamic pricing adjustments.
The goal: free up your time for strategy, product development, and high-level customer interactions.

1. Gorgias: AI-Powered Customer Service
Primary Function: Centralizes all customer queries (email, live chat, social media) into one dashboard and uses AI to automate responses.
Key Features:
- Automated ticket routing and prioritization
- AI-suggested macro responses for common questions
- Integrates directly with Shopify order data
- Rules engine to auto-resolve issues (e.g., "send tracking info when a customer asks 'where is my order?'")
Pricing:
- Starter: $60/month (300 tickets/month)
- Basic: $300/month (2,000 tickets/month)
- Pro: $750/month (5,000 tickets/month)
Pros:
- Reduces response time from hours to minutes
- One dashboard for all channels
- Built-in Shopify integration means less manual data lookup
Cons:
- Starter plan ticket limit is low for growing stores
- AI suggestions require initial setup and training
Who Should Use This: Stores receiving 100+ customer inquiries per month who want to cut service time without hiring staff.
2. Octane AI: Quiz & Survey Builder for Personalized Marketing
Primary Function: Creates interactive quizzes ("Find your perfect skincare routine") that collect customer data and then uses AI to recommend products and automate follow-up SMS/email sequences.
Key Features:
- AI-driven product recommendation logic based on quiz answers
- Automatically adds quiz data to customer profiles
- Triggers personalized post-purchase SMS flows
Pricing:
- Starter: $50/month (up to 500 quiz submissions/month)
- Growth: $200/month (up to 2,500 submissions/month)
Pros:
- Directly increases conversion rates via personalized recommendations
- Captures zero-party data (customer preferences) for future marketing
- Automated flows run without daily input
Cons:
- Requires upfront quiz design work
- Best for stores with products that suit a "recommendation" model (e.g., cosmetics, supplements)
Who Should Use This: Stores selling products where personalization matters (e.g., beauty, wellness, fashion) and want to automate lead qualification and post-purchase engagement.
3. Reply.ai: Shopify-Native Chatbot
Primary Function: An AI chatbot installed directly on your Shopify store that answers customer questions 24/7 and can automate tasks like order lookup and return initiation.
Key Features:
- Trained specifically on Shopify data schema (orders, products, policies)
- Can be configured to handle returns/refunds within policy rules
- Integrates with Shopify Flow for automated backend actions
Pricing:
- Basic: $29/month (up to 500 conversations/month)
- Professional: $99/month (up to 2,000 conversations/month)
Pros:
- Lower cost than full customer service platforms like Gorgias
- True 24/7 availability
- Simple setup focused purely on chat
Cons:
- Limited to chat channel only
- Less sophisticated ticket management for complex issues
Who Should Use This: Stores that need a basic, affordable, always-on chat assistant to handle the most common 50-100 questions.
4. Copysmith: AI Content Generation for Product Descriptions & Ads
Primary Function: Generates marketing copy, including product descriptions, Facebook/Google ad copy, email subject lines, and blog post drafts.
Key Features:
- Shopify integration for bulk product description generation
- Tone adjustment (formal, casual, persuasive)
- SEO keyword integration for meta descriptions
Pricing:
- Starter: $19/month (100 credits/month)
- Professional: $59/month (500 credits/month)
- Enterprise: $499/month (custom credits)
Pros:
- Dramatically speeds up content creation for new products
- Creates consistent copy across products
- Can refresh old descriptions for SEO
Cons:
- Output requires human review for brand voice alignment
- Best for draft generation, not final polished copy
Who Should Use This: Stores adding 10+ new products monthly or running frequent ad campaigns who need to automate the initial copy draft process.
5. Vesta: AI Fraud Detection & Order Review
Primary Function: Automatically reviews every order for fraud risk using AI models, reducing manual review time and chargebacks.
Key Features:
- Real-time scoring of each transaction
- Automated decisioning (approve, review, decline)
- Integrates with Shopify orders
Pricing:
- Pay-per-transaction model: $0.10 - $0.30 per order, depending on volume.
- Typically ranges from $20-$150/month for a store processing 200-1,500 orders.
Pros:
- Reduces chargebacks by 50-80%
- Eliminates hours of manual order review
- No upfront monthly commit, scales with orders
Cons:
- Cost scales with order volume
- Requires some initial rule configuration
Who Should Use This: Stores processing 200+ orders monthly, especially in high-risk categories (electronics, luxury goods), where fraud and chargebacks are a concern.

Implementation Strategy: Start Small, Scale Smart
- Identify Your Biggest Time Drain: Is it answering customer emails? Writing product descriptions? Reviewing orders for fraud? Pick the one task consuming 5+ hours weekly.
- Choose One Tool to Solve It: From the list above, select the tool that directly addresses that drain. Start with the lowest viable plan.
- Configure & Train Over 1 Week: Spend a week setting up rules, training AI responses, or integrating the tool. Expect an initial time investment.
- Monitor for 30 Days: Check results: reduced time spent, improved metrics (response time, conversion rate, chargeback rate).
- Add a Second Tool: Only after the first is running smoothly, automate another area.
